i found out and forgot to update this.

so the the 505 needs you to send a program change message on channel 1 to give you access to the other banks.

so

you need a "Program Change note 0" to get back to pad-bank1.

you need a "Program Change note 1" to get back to pad-bank2.

you need a "Program Change note 2" to get back to pad-bank3. ect...

all the banks respond to midi notes 36-51 on whichever channel you have selected on "Pads Ch" under "system utility midi".
